i have used rhapsody, napster, yahoo music, and mtv urge. rhapsody is the best by far, and i don't have any issues similar to what ribsauce described. it is so much better when paired with the e200r player though. microsoft developed playsforsure drm, it's used exclusively on every site i listed above except rhapsody which supports it as well as their own helix drm (w/the e200r). microsoft doesn't use playsforsure on the zune even though it's their own device and their own drm. how telling is that? it's pretty incredible that they expect everyone else to continue using it.
